DIY Farmer’s Dog Food

Description

A nutritious and homemade meal for your furry friend, packed with high-quality proteins and vibrant vegetables.


Ingredients

  • Lean beef or chicken (high-quality proteins)
  • Sweet potatoes
  • Brown rice or quinoa
  • Fresh or frozen carrots and peas
  • Rolled oats or quinoa (grains)

Instructions

  1. Cook the protein source in a large pot over medium heat until fully cooked, around 10 minutes for chicken or 15 minutes for beef. Shred or chop into small pieces.
  2. Prepare sweet potatoes and rice according to package instructions. Sweet potatoes take about 20 minutes, while rice takes about 15-20 minutes.
  3. Chop veggies and steam them in a steamer basket over boiling water for 5-7 minutes until tender.
  4. In a large bowl, mix the cooked protein, grains, and steamed vegetables. Stir well to combine.
  5. Allow the mix to cool to room temperature before serving.

Notes

You can double the recipe and freeze portions for quick future meals. Always cool before serving to avoid burns.
